Job Description

\rJob Description \r

Manages, plans, and oversees the activities of the HR Solutions. Participates in the design and implementation of HR solutions strategies, plans and activities on HR-led projects and initiatives to maximize employee adoption and minimize resistance.The responsibility of the HR Solutions Project Portfolio Manager is to manage the portfolio management process and to ensure that it runs effectively and smoothly. The HR Solutions Project Portfolio Manager is the subject matter expert on portfolio management. Also, develops and is responsible for executing the portfolio management process which includes; Initiative ideation, intake, prioritization, portfolio planning and optimization, resource capacity planning, portfolio risk management and governance, reporting and communication.

Job Responsibility

\r


\r

  • \r

  • Provides leadership to Organizational Development team members and supervisors by communicating and guiding toward achieving department objectives.

  • \r

  • Develops, communicates, and builds consensus for goals in alignment with the health system.

  • \r

  • Participates in developing and executing HR Solutions plans designed to drive employee adoption and minimize resistance.

  • \r

  • Supports the design and deployment of tools and activities on large-scale initiatives, including but not limited to stakeholder analysis and change impact analysis.

  • \r

  • Assists in the design and execution of interviews, surveys, focus groups and other measurement tools to assess stakeholders readiness level for change; writes and produces various communications to drive organizational change and influence behaviors.

  • \r

  • Coordinates with subject matter experts to identify training requirements and designs holistic, integrated training plans to drive adoption of the health systems, processes and programs.

  • \r

  • Identifies and engages change agents to disseminate information and gather feedback on large-scale change projects.

  • \r

  • Identifies change metrics to track and coordinates with subject matter experts to build and maintain metrics scorecard for projects.

  • \r

  • Builds relationships within HR to drive awareness of the function and position the function to provide maximum value to the organization.

  • \r

  • Coordinates and facilitates interactive working sessions and meetings with project sponsors, workgroups and other key stakeholders to discuss the approach. Serves as a change management mentor to team members.

  • \r

  • Performs related duties as required. All responsibilities noted here are considered essential functions of the job under the Americans with Disabilities Act. Duties not mentioned here, but considered related are not essential functions.

Job Qualification

\r


\r

  • \r

  • Bachelor's Degree required, or equivalent combination of education and related experience.

  • \r

  • 6-8 years of relevant experience and 2-5 years of leadership / management experience, required.

  • \r

  • Project management and Agile certifications (e.g., PMP, SAFe, CSM, CSPO, etc.) highly preferred.

  • \r

  • 5+ years of experience managing project portfolios in blended Agile and traditional PPM environments, highly preferred.

  • \r

  • Experience with modern PPM tools, highly preferred.

  • \r

  • Skilled in coaching and mentoring program and project managers experience, highly preferred.
